Which of the following observations would seem to contradict the cell theory?

a unicellular organism is discovered that has a nucleus and a flagellum
O protein chains display lifelike mobility in moving through a cell
Ο Ο Ο Ο
a daughter cell has the same chromosomes as a parent cell
cells do not grow past a certain size

Answer:

protein chains display lifelike mobility in moving through a cell

Step-by-step explanation:

One part of the cell theory as proposed by Mathias Scleiden, Rudolf Virchow and Theodor Schwann in 1830's states that: Cell is the fundamental and basic unit of life. This means that cell is the lowest form of any living thing that can be found.

However, in a case whereby protein chains display lifelike mobility in moving through a cell, this opposes the universal cell theory in the sense that protein molecule cannot display characteristics of life (movement) in a cell when the basic unit is CELL itself.
